Output 6e80054b922a60938f05bcb96f39bdc5647c7e25a264c3d61ed6f5a1e642d0b7:7

value
6780536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8e761f146a0604e34a5b6eb06d28b646341724 OP_EQUAL
address
3DEBj79YZCowviiWaxF3DWjksPHezt16yZ
transaction
6e80054b922a60938f05bcb96f39bdc5647c7e25a264c3d61ed6f5a1e642d0b7
confirmations
487995
spent
true